DOI:. 试验研究外源抗氧化剂对高温胁迫下红地球葡萄果皮组织 CAT 、 APX 和 SOD 酶活性的影响王文举,王振平* (宁夏大学农学院/ 葡萄与葡萄酒教育部工程研究中心/ 宁夏葡萄与葡萄酒研究院,银川 750021 ) 摘要:以红地球葡萄为试材,喷施抗坏血酸( Vc )、苯甲酸钠( SBN )、水杨酸( SA )、柠檬酸( CA )、***化钙( CaCl 2 )等 5 种抗氧化剂,研究不同外源抗氧化剂对高温胁迫下果皮组织中过氧化氢酶( CAT )、抗坏血酸过氧化物酶( APX )、超氧化物歧化酶( SOD )活性的影响。结果表明:喷施外源抗氧化剂均能显著提高果皮组织内 CAT 、 APX 和 SOD 的活性。综合分析:以 Vc 10 mmol/L , SA mmol/L , CA 10 mmol/L , Vc 10 mmol/L+CaCl 2 1000 mg/L , Vc 10 mmol+SBN 10 mmol/L 为极显著。关键词:葡萄果皮组织;高温胁迫;外源抗氧化剂;酶活性中图分类号: 文献标志码:A Effects of exogenous antioxidants on CAT, APX and SOD activity in Red Globe grape skin under high temperature stress Wang Wenju, Wang Zhenping* (Agriculture College of Ningxia University, Ningxia University Engineering Research Center of Grape and Wine, Ministry of Education, Yinchuan 750021) Abstract : Red Globe grape was sprayed with ascorbic acid, sodium benzoate, salicylic acid, citric acid, calcium chloride to study the effect of different exogenous antioxidants on the activity of catalase(CAT), ascorbate peroxidase(APX), superoxide dismutase(SOD) in the grape skin under high temperature stress.
